NEVER change the OE twinscroll headers if you have them to begin with. They are great bits of kit and I have not had any problems for over 41k miles, with 16+k being at over 500bhp.

Just get a twin to single scroll up-pipe like I have on the Spec C, which enables you to run a single scroll standard position turbo on the OE twinscroll headers.
